About Disodium Oleyl Sulfosuccinate
Disodium Oleyl Sulfosuccinate is the disodium salt of the oleyl alcohol half ester of sulfosuccinic acid.[1] In cosmetics, it is used to help sebum and impurities rinse away with water, increase the amount of foam and help it last longer, and help ingredients that do not dissolve readily in water disperse more evenly in the water phase.[2] It is also used to reduce surface tension so raw materials can wet, mix, and disperse evenly.[2]
